Thanks Ozpaph

I just use natural light - no artificial lights or flashes. I shoot under my back pergola. You might get some idea from this photo.

Given the dominance of the black background (can result in overexposed photos), I often underexpose the photo a bit. A bit of trial and error. I shoot RAW. In Photoshop I often do the following -

* increase the black levels to ensure I can't see any black fabric
* increase the clarity and vibrance a bit
* increase the contrast
* Sharpen the photo.
